| Age | Commit message (Expand) | Author |
| 2023-10-24 | Remove 'shadow' and merge into 'nss' | Arjun Shankar |
| 2023-03-27 | Move libc_freeres_ptrs and libc_subfreeres to hidden/weak functions | Adhemerval Zanella Netto |
| 2023-01-06 | Update copyright dates with scripts/update-copyrights | Joseph Myers |
| 2022-03-14 | Add access function attributes to grp and shadow headers | Steve Grubb |
| 2022-01-01 | Update copyright dates with scripts/update-copyrights | Paul Eggert |
| 2021-09-03 | Remove "Contributed by" lines | Siddhesh Poyarekar |
| 2021-01-02 | Update copyright dates with scripts/update-copyrights | Paul Eggert |
| 2020-07-21 | shadow: Implement fgetspent_r using __nss_fgetent_r | Florian Weimer |
| 2020-01-01 | Update copyright dates with scripts/update-copyrights. | Joseph Myers |
| 2019-09-07 | Prefer https to http for gnu.org and fsf.org URLs | Paul Eggert |
| 2019-02-25 | Break more lines before not after operators. | Joseph Myers |
| 2019-01-01 | Update copyright dates with scripts/update-copyrights. | Joseph Myers |
| 2018-06-29 | manual: Revise crypt.texi. | Zack Weinberg |
| 2018-01-01 | Update copyright dates with scripts/update-copyrights. | Joseph Myers |
| 2017-12-11 | Replace = with += in CFLAGS-xxx.c/CPPFLAGS-xxx.c | H.J. Lu |
| 2017-06-08 | Remove __need macros from stdio.h and wchar.h. | Zack Weinberg |
| 2017-05-20 | Remove __need macros from signal.h. | Zack Weinberg |
| 2017-04-18 | Assume that O_CLOEXEC is always defined and works | Florian Weimer |
| 2017-01-01 | Update copyright dates with scripts/update-copyrights. | Joseph Myers |
| 2016-01-04 | Update copyright dates with scripts/update-copyrights. | Joseph Myers |
| 2015-10-02 | Harden putpwent, putgrent, putspent, putspent against injection [BZ #18724] | Florian Weimer |
| 2015-09-08 | Move bits/libc-lock.h and bits/libc-lockP.h out of bits/ (bug 14912). | Joseph Myers |
| 2015-01-02 | Update copyright dates with scripts/update-copyrights. | Joseph Myers |
| 2014-02-26 | Consistently include Makeconfig after defining subdir. | Joseph Myers |
| 2014-01-01 | Update copyright notices with scripts/update-copyrights | Allan McRae |
| 2013-01-02 | Update copyright notices with scripts/update-copyrights. | Joseph Myers |
| 2012-08-22 | Fix shadow, gshadow, networks, protocols, rpc, aliases, and nscd routines for... | Roland McGrath |
| 2012-08-17 | Clean up definition of _LIBC_REENTRANT and _IO_MTSAFE_IO. | Roland McGrath |
| 2012-02-09 | Replace FSF snail mail address with URLs. | Paul Eggert |
| 2012-01-07 | Remove pre-ISO C support | Ulrich Drepper |
| 2011-09-10 | Cleanup of configuration options | Ulrich Drepper |
| 2011-05-29 | Interpret numeric values in shadow file as signed | Ulrich Drepper |
| 2011-02-02 | Fix range error handling in sgetspent. | Andreas Schwab |
| 2009-04-23 | * shadow/sgetspent_r.c (__sgetspent_r): Recognize too small buffers. | Ulrich Drepper |
| 2009-04-23 | * shadow/Makefile (tests): Add tst-shadow. | Ulrich Drepper |
| 2009-02-26 | 2009-02-26 Roland McGrath <roland@redhat.com> | Roland McGrath |
| 2007-08-11 | * shadow/lckpwdf.c (__lckpwdf): Use O_CLOEXEC if possible. | Ulrich Drepper |
| 2005-02-02 | * sysdeps/mach/hurd/tls.h: Include <stdbool.h> | Roland McGrath |
| 2004-12-22 | (CFLAGS-tst-align.c): Add -mpreferred-stack-boundary=4. | Ulrich Drepper |
| 2007-07-12 | 2.5-18.1 | Jakub Jelinek |
| 2004-02-09 | Update. | Ulrich Drepper |
| 2003-09-12 | Update. | Ulrich Drepper |
| 2003-09-03 | Update. | Ulrich Drepper |
| 2003-04-19 | Update. | Ulrich Drepper |
| 2002-11-01 | * include/libc-symbols.h (__libc_freeres_fn_section, libc_freeres_fn): | Roland McGrath |
| 2002-08-03 | * include/stdlib.h: Use libc_hidden_proto for qsort. | Roland McGrath |
| 2002-08-03 | Update. | Ulrich Drepper |
| 2002-04-07 | Update. | Ulrich Drepper |
| 2001-07-06 | Update to LGPL v2.1. | Andreas Jaeger |
| 2000-08-21 | Update. | Ulrich Drepper |